Although the Banjo Rehabilitation Center  is exclusively a “banjo shop”,  our sturdy little CEO sagaciously promotes musical diversity to enrich the artful climate of the workplace. In the attached informal photo,  the CEO gently instructs the grandfatherly BRC founder on the modal features of the Mixolydian scale by using the harmonica as a teaching tool. During this back porch tutorial, the CEO points-out  that the harmonica (as played by Jimmy Fadden) was seamlessly merged into the Bluegrass ensemble as heard on the  ground-breaking double album “Will the Circle Be Unbroken” released  a generation ago.
